Description
Tetrahydrozoline Hydrochloride, soluble in DMSO, ethanol and water, inhibits the signaling pathway between G-protein-coupled receptors (GPCRs) and G proteins. It targets α-adrenergic receptor.

Solubility
DMSO: 12 mg/mL (50.68 mM); Water: 46 mg/mL (194.31 mM); Ethanol: 25 mg/mL (105.6 mM)
Stability
The product is stable for three years when stored at the recommended temperature in lyophilized powder.
Applications
Tetrahydrozoline hydrochloride can be used for its vasoconstrictive properties.
Storage
Store at -20°C, and keep desiccated.
